Transaction 41ad5209d17498a958790cabf6fd7bffa784be654087d48b111c4de6a5efcb16

1 Input
2 Outputs
  • 41ad5209d17498a958790cabf6fd7bffa784be654087d48b111c4de6a5efcb16:0
  • value  384339427
    address  1PBf3SVaHJXjrn2xTh5Pci95L7oieEP5t8
  • 41ad5209d17498a958790cabf6fd7bffa784be654087d48b111c4de6a5efcb16:1
  • value  22990798
    address  171gTtopUk4MzxqN96r1LuPmpf7ET7wMvH